Energy Efficiency
59B, Burghley Road has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 07 Apr 2025.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has single glazed windows. It is heated using No system present: electric heaters assumed.

Location Comparison
Of the 203 addresses on Burghley Road, London, NW5, 59B, Burghley Road comes out as the 62nd largest and the 48th most expensive in our analysis of the public data.
It is also £224k more expensive than the average property across the NW5 district.
